Freedom and Independence Butterflies are often seen as symbols of freedom and independence due to their ability to fly and roam the world with grace and ease. A butterfly tattoo can represent a newfound sense of freedom, a desire for exploration, or a celebration of autonomy and self-reliance. Delicacy and Fragility
